The ESV puts it this way: “When the perfect comes, the partial will pass away.” The “in part” or “partial” things are the gifts of prophecy, knowledge, and tongues (verses 8–9). The King James Bible uses the word “charity” instead of “love” based on the Greek word ἀγάπη (agapē) which also signifies affection, good will and benevolence. Barnes's 1-corinthians 13:8 Bible Commentary Charity never faileth - Paul here proceeds to illustrate the value of love, from its "permanency" as compared with other valued endowments.
